Dopplerprinzip und Bohrsche Frequenzbedingung. SS. 301-303. In: Physikalische Zeitschrift. Jg. 23.
Leipzig, Hirzel, 1922. - (27,5 x 20 cm). XII, 560 S. Mit zahlreichen Abbildungen und 14 Tafeln. Halbleinwandband der Zeit.
Erste Ausgabe. - "By applying the laws of conservation of energy and of momentum to the emission of a quantum from an excited atom, he calculated the correction to the Bohr formula due to the recoil velocity of the quantum. The calculated effect was too small to be detected even for emission of quanta in the far ultraviolet. In this paper, the independent existence of light particles was taken for granted. If he had extended his considerations to X-ray quanta, he might have made a major discovery, the Compton effect" (Moore, Schrödinger). - Papierbedingt leicht gebräunt. Einband leicht berieben, sonst gut erhalten. - Der Band enthält weiter Arbeiten u.a. von M. Born, E. Fermi, J. Franck, O. Hahn, W. Heisenberg und L. Meitner
